Kilmeston is a small village and civil parish in the Winchester District or City of Winchester of Hampshire.
Kilmeston Manor, a substantial country house, is a grade II* listed building.
The parish church of St Andrew has its origin in medieval times. Rebuilt in 1772 and again in the late 19th century, it is a grade II listed building.
